Achieving Balanced Blood Sugar with Natural Solutions
In today’s fast-paced world, maintaining balanced blood sugar levels is crucial for overall health and well-being. Imbalances can lead to various health issues, including fatigue, irritability, and even serious conditions like diabetes. Fortunately, there are natural solutions that can help stabilize blood sugar levels, making it easier to lead a healthy lifestyle.
One of the most effective natural strategies for regulating blood sugar is through diet. Consuming foods that have a low glycemic index (GI) is essential. Low-GI foods release glucose slowly into the bloodstream, preventing spikes in blood sugar levels. Examples include whole grains, legumes, nuts, seeds, and most fruits and vegetables. Integrating these foods into daily meals can contribute to better blood sugar control.
In addition to food choices, meal timing and portion control play significant roles in blood sugar regulation. Eating smaller, more frequent meals throughout the day helps keep blood sugar levels stable. Skipping meals or consuming large portions can lead to dramatic fluctuations. Balancing carbohydrates with protein and healthy fats at each meal is another effective tactic. This combination can slow digestion and promote a more gradual release of glucose into the bloodstream.
Incorporating certain herbs and spices into your diet can also be beneficial. Cinnamon, for instance, has been shown to improve insulin sensitivity and lower fasting blood sugar levels. Other spices such as fenugreek, turmeric, and ginger may also support healthy blood sugar levels and overall metabolic function. Adding these spices not only enhances flavor but also packs a nutritional punch.
Physical activity is another potent tool for achieving balanced blood sugar. Engaging in regular exercise helps muscles use glucose more effectively, thus lowering blood sugar levels. Moderate-intensity aerobic exercises, such as brisk walking, swimming, or cycling, are excellent choices. Strength training is also critical as it builds muscle mass, which, in turn, improves insulin sensitivity.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ise each week, combined with muscle-strengthening activities on two or more days.
Hydration plays an often-overlooked role in blood sugar regulation. Dehydration can lead to higher blood sugar levels, as insufficient water in the body can cause glucose concentration to increase. Drinking enough water throughout the day not only aids digestion but also helps maintain normal blood volume and supports overall body functions. Aim for at least eight glasses of water a day, adjusting for factors like exercise and climate.
Stress management is equally important for balanced blood sugar. Stress triggers the release of hormones, like cortisol, which can raise blood sugar levels. Incorporating stress-reduction techniques such as meditation, deep-breathing exercises, or yoga can be profoundly beneficial. Finding time to unwind and engage in hobbies or activities you enjoy can also help mitigate stress.
Sleep quality should not be underestimated when considering blood sugar levels. Poor sleep can disrupt hormone production and lead to increased insulin resistance. Striving for at least 7-9 hours of restorative sleep each night can enhance metabolic function, regulate hormones, and promote better blood sugar balance.
Lastly, consider the possibility of using natural supplements that have been shown to support blood sugar control. Supplements such as alpha-lipoic acid, chromium, and berberine may help improve insulin sensitivity and glucose metabolism. However, it’s essential to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new supplement regimen to ensure it’s appropriate for your personal health needs.
